Types of Stair Parts


China Stair Parts Suppliers and Wholesalers - TradeWheel

There are several types of stair parts, each serving a specific function and design aesthetic. Below is a comparison table of the different types of stair parts commonly available in China.

Type Description Typical Uses
Handrails Provides support; can be made of wood, metal, or glass. Residential and commercial staircases.
Balusters Vertical posts that support the handrail; available in various designs. Enhances safety and aesthetic appeal.
Treads The horizontal part of the stair where you step; can be wood or metal. Essential for all types of staircases.
Nosing The front edge of the tread; provides safety and prevents slipping. Applied to all types of stairs for safety.
Railing Systems Complete railing assemblies that include posts, handrails, and infills. Used in commercial buildings, parks, etc.
Staircases Various designs including straight, spiral, and curved. Used in homes, commercial buildings, and public spaces.

Choosing the Right Stair Parts


Stairs & Stair Parts Manufacturers & Suppliers from China - TradeWheel

When selecting stair parts, consider the following factors:

  1. Material: Choose materials that suit the intended use of the staircase. For example, wooden parts may be preferable for indoor residential settings, while metal parts might be more suitable for commercial applications.

  2. Design: The design should complement the overall architecture of the building. Glass railings can provide a modern look, while wooden components may offer a classic appeal.

  3. Safety Features: Ensure that the stair parts comply with safety regulations. Features like non-slip nosing and sturdy handrails are crucial for preventing accidents.

  4. Cost: Balance quality with budget. While it might be tempting to go for the cheapest option, investing in durable materials can save money in the long run.
